Direct Requirement Coefficients (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019)

Direct requirement coefficients for Singapore's industries, derived from the Industry by Industry Input-Output Table in the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019 published by the Singapore Department of Statistics. Each column shows the inputs needed for every 1,000 units of an industry's output, split into direct inputs from other industries, imports of goods and services, taxes less subsidies on products, and income components of value added. Columns cover some fifty detailed industry groups spanning agriculture, food, chemicals, semiconductors, machinery, transport equipment, and utilities. Economists use the coefficients for production-structure modelling, cost pass-through studies, and building Leontief multipliers for the Singapore economy. Forward And Backward Linkages (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019)

Forward and backward linkage coefficients from Singapore’s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019. Forward linkages measure dependence on downstream purchases; backward linkages measure dependence on upstream production. Industry analysts rank sectors by supply- and demand-side connectedness in the Singapore economy. Adapted from SingStat TableBuilder CT/17841.

Input-Output Multipliers (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019)

Singapore Department of Statistics CSV of input-output multipliers derived from the Supply, Use and Input-Output Tables 2019. For each industry the table reports total, direct and indirect multipliers for output, value added, imports, and compensation of employees. Economists and policy analysts use these coefficients to estimate economy-wide effects of demand changes, assess inter-industry linkages, and model the domestic value added and import content of Singapore's production.
